沈阳做网站找思路如何在本地搭建网站
2026/3/28 5:26:50 网站建设 项目流程
沈阳做网站找思路,如何在本地搭建网站,如何查网站注册信息,怎么查看一个网站做的外链Docker-Android容器化实践#xff1a;解决传统Android开发痛点的完整方案 【免费下载链接】docker-android 项目地址: https://gitcode.com/gh_mirrors/doc/docker-android 传统Android开发环境面临着配置复杂、环境依赖性强、资源占用高等诸多挑战。Docker-Android项…Docker-Android容器化实践解决传统Android开发痛点的完整方案【免费下载链接】docker-android项目地址: https://gitcode.com/gh_mirrors/doc/docker-android传统Android开发环境面临着配置复杂、环境依赖性强、资源占用高等诸多挑战。Docker-Android项目通过容器化技术为移动应用开发和测试提供了革命性的解决方案。本文将深入探讨如何利用Docker-Android优化您的开发工作流程。传统Android开发环境的困境在传统的Android开发中开发者经常遇到以下问题环境配置复杂需要安装JDK、Android SDK、模拟器等多个组件系统资源占用高模拟器运行时消耗大量CPU和内存环境隔离性差不同项目可能产生依赖冲突CI/CD集成困难自动化测试环境搭建繁琐Docker-Android的核心优势Docker-Android通过容器化技术实现了Android环境的标准化和轻量化一键部署通过Docker命令快速启动完整的Android环境资源隔离每个容器独立运行互不干扰版本控制支持多个Android版本和API级别云端就绪天然适合云原生架构和持续集成5分钟快速部署指南环境准备确保系统满足以下要求Docker 20.10KVM硬件虚拟化支持至少4GB可用内存启动第一个Android容器docker run -d \ -p 6080:6080 \ -p 5554:5554 \ -p 5555:5555 \ -e EMULATOR_DEVICESamsung Galaxy S10 \ -e WEB_VNCtrue \ --device /dev/kvm \ budtmo/docker-android:emulator_11.0验证部署结果访问http://localhost:6080查看运行中的Android容器您将看到完整的Android系统界面。支持的Android版本和设备配置Docker-Android提供全面的版本支持Android版本API级别设备支持9.0 (Pie)28三星Galaxy S9/S8, Nexus系列10.029三星Galaxy S10, Pixel系列11.030三星Galaxy S10, S20系列12.032最新设备支持实际应用场景深度解析移动应用自动化测试集成Appium服务器实现跨平台自动化测试docker run -p 4723:4723 \ -e APPIUMtrue \ -e CONNECT_TO_GRIDtrue \ budtmo/docker-android:emulator_11.0持续集成环境搭建与Jenkins无缝集成优化CI/CD流水线# 在Jenkins Pipeline中使用 pipeline { agent any stages { stage(Android Test) { steps { sh docker run --rm budtmo/docker-android:emulator_11.0 } } } }高级配置与优化技巧环境变量定制通过环境变量深度定制容器行为docker run -e EMULATOR_NAMEcustom-emulator \ -e EMULATOR_DATA_PARTITION4G \ budtmo/docker-android:emulator_11.0数据持久化配置避免容器重启导致数据丢失docker run -v android_data:/home/androidusr \ budtmo/docker-android:emulator_11.0网络配置优化配置容器网络以适应不同环境docker run --network host \ budtmo/docker-android:emulator_11.0性能监控与故障排查实时状态监控docker exec -it container-name cat device_status日志分析通过Web界面访问详细日志docker run -e WEB_LOGtrue -e WEB_LOG_PORT9001企业级部署最佳实践对于生产环境部署建议采用以下策略资源限制为容器设置合理的CPU和内存限制健康检查配置容器健康检查机制备份策略定期备份重要数据和配置总结与展望Docker-Android项目通过容器化技术成功解决了传统Android开发环境中的诸多痛点。无论是个人开发者还是企业团队都能从中获得显著的效率提升。随着云原生技术的不断发展容器化的Android开发环境将成为行业标准。通过本文的实践指南您可以快速掌握Docker-Android的核心用法并将其应用于实际的项目开发中。立即开始您的容器化Android开发之旅体验现代化开发流程带来的便利与高效【免费下载链接】docker-android项目地址: https://gitcode.com/gh_mirrors/doc/docker-android创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询